Community Mobilization for Jason’s Next Status Hearing
Supporters of Jason Vassell will be mobilizing outside the Hampshire Superior Court in Northampton on Thursday, August 6th at 2PM. Following the hearing, Jason’s lawyers will debrief the community on Judge Carhart’s decisions and the status of the case in general.
THURSDAY, August 6th @ 2PM
Hampshire Superior Court
15 Gothic Street
Northampton, MA 01060
It is likely that the discussion will center around whether Carhart intends to have an evidentiary hearing prior to submitting a written report to the Supreme Judicial Court of Massachusetts in support of his Discovery Order from late February.
